What does Succinct do Simply put, Succinct is like the "AWS of ZK", building a global, decentralized two-sided marketplace on Ethereum: Proof requesters and Provers match through an auction mechanism to generate ZKP. By using @ SuccinchLabs' core technology SP1 zkVM (Zero Knowledge Virtual Machine), developers can generate ZK proofs by writing code in common languages such as Rust, without the need for complex underlying technologies such as cryptography or circuit design. Significantly reduced the threshold for ZK development. 2/The role of ZK technology in it When it comes to ZK, we can easily think of L2 expansion solutions such as ZK Rollup. The focus of Succinct is not on scaling, but on building a decentralized ZK provisioning infrastructure (hence the token ticket is called Prove), creating an open market that allows developers to write ZK applications like regular programs, lowering the barrier to entry; Simultaneously motivate Provers to provide low-cost and reliable proof services. In this business, ZK technology is mainly reflected in privacy protection, cross chain verification, secure computing, lightweight clients, and other aspects, making the verification process more trustworthy, secure, and efficient. This is also the core technical support of the Succinct project. 3/Use case scenarios and users of Succinct There are many web3 projects using Succinct, including public chains such as Polygon, Taiko, and Morph, as well as dApps such as Celestia and Lido. The use case scenarios involved in the collaboration between these projects and Succinct include: Zk EVM: A proof of Ethereum block execution based on SP1, which can quickly deploy zkEVM. Rollups: Generate proof of validity for state transitions, which can be bridged to Ethereum or other chains. Identity and Privacy: Client proof generation, supporting private voting and anonymous identity. AI and Generative Applications: Provide verifiable support for AI agents, generative art, user customized experiences, etc. in an on chain environment. Interoperability: Perform cryptographic operations such as elliptic curve to expand EVM capabilities. 4/PROVE Economic Model PROVE is not just a governance token, but also includes functions such as payment, security, and incentives in the Succinct network. Payment tool: The requester needs to use PROVE payment proof to generate fees. Network security and equity pledge: Provers need to pledge PROVE in order to participate in the auction as an economic guarantee. Pledge Entrustment: The holder can entrust the PROVE to the verifier to share the profits. Governance and Incentives: PROVE holders can vote to participate in governance and incentivize validators to improve infrastructure. The Succinct team is technology driven and has raised $56 million in two rounds before TGE. However, now that @ Binance has been launched, the reference value of financing data is not significant, and we have entered the stage of sufficient market competition.
